Long-term bone remodeling after definitive decompression for jaw cysts based on a three-dimensional analysis

Summary
Definitive decompression effectively reduces jaw cysts, with bone remodeling continuing long after treatment. This method offers a viable option for most patients, though long-term monitoring is essential.
Area of Science:
- Oral and Maxillofacial Surgery
- Dental Radiology
- Bone Regeneration
Background:
- Jaw cysts are commonly treated with decompression as a preliminary step before enucleation.
- This study investigates long-term bone remodeling following definitive decompression for jaw cysts.
Purpose of the Study:
- To evaluate long-term bone remodeling after definitive decompression for jaw cysts using three-dimensional (3D) analysis.
- To assess the efficacy of definitive decompression as a standalone treatment for jaw cysts.
Main Methods:
- Retrospective analysis of clinical and radiological data from patients with jaw cysts.
- Review of data from patients treated between January 2015 and December 2020 with at least two years of follow-up.
- Three-dimensional (3D) radiological analysis to assess cyst reduction and bone remodeling over time.
Main Results:
- A mean cyst reduction rate of 78% was observed one year after decompression, increasing to 86% at an average of 36.1 months.
- Slow ossification of unossified lesions continued beyond one year post-decompression.
- A low recurrence rate of 5.9% was recorded.
Conclusions:
- Bone remodeling is a prolonged process following jaw cyst decompression.
- Definitive decompression is a suitable treatment option for the majority of patients with jaw cysts.
- Extended follow-up is crucial for monitoring long-term outcomes.
